Ronnie Ranson Obituary

Ronnie L. Ranson, 66, of Cecil, Pa., passed away peacefully Friday, March 28, 2014, at Allegheny General Hospital, in Pittsburg, following a brief illness, surrounded by his loving family.

He was born Jan. 13, 1948, in Jacksonville, the only son of Mardelle Vieira Ranson of Jacksonville and the late Denby Ranson. Mr. Ranson served with the United States Army and was a member of the American Legion Post 902 of Houston. He was Presbyterian by faith and resided in the Pittsburg area since 1978. He had attended Illinois College, Bowman Technical School for jewelry repair and Zantech for watch making. Mr. Ranson, along with his wife, Cynthia, owned and operated Ranson Jewelers in Canonsburg, Pa., since August of 1979.

He was a member of the National Rifle Association and enjoyed spending time with his family. On July 17, 1971, he married Cynthia D. DelFine, who survives. Also left to cherish his memory are his three children, Phaedra (Trent) Nunley of Niceville, Fla., Corbin Ranson of Canonsburg, Pa., and Casey (Sarah) Ranson of Tyler, Texas; four grandchildren; Hailey, Delaney and Ava Nunley and Joseph Ranson; and several nieces, nephews and cousins.

Funeral services were held Monday, March 31, 2014. Full military rites were accorded by the VFW Post 191 honor guard.
